There can be some confusion about mortgage insurance and FHA mortgage loans-mostly because of the nature of the insurance needed; conventional home loans normally require the borrower to carry Private Mortgage Insurance (PMI) unless a specific down payment amount is made.

That depends on a variety of factors including credit scores and what kind of credit risk the conventional lender thinks you might be. FHA mortgage loans typically require a minimum 3.5% down.

The Benefits of a Conventional Loan . You can make a down payment as low as 3%. If your down payment is at least 20%, you can avoid paying private mortgage insurance (PMI).
